Understanding Polycystic Ovary Syndrome (PCOS) Symptoms: What You Need to Know

Polycystic Ovary Syndrome (PCOS) is a common hormonal disorder that affects women of reproductive age. It occurs due to hormonal imbalance, which can lead to irregular ovulation, cysts in the ovaries, and increased levels of male hormones (androgens). As a result, it impacts menstrual cycles, fertility, metabolism, and overall health.

Although the exact cause of Polycystic Ovary Syndrome is not fully known, researchers believe genetics, insulin resistance, and inflammation play vital roles.


Common Symptoms of Polycystic Ovary Syndrome (PCOS)

The symptoms of Polycystic Ovary Syndrome may vary from woman to woman, and some may develop gradually. Early detection and treatment can prevent long-term complications.

1. Irregular Menstrual Cycles – Polycystic Ovary Syndrome (PCOS)

Women with PCOS often face:

  • Infrequent periods (less than 8 per year)
  • Prolonged cycles (more than 35 days)
  • Missed periods (amenorrhea)
  • Very heavy or very light bleeding

This irregularity occurs due to failure of the ovaries to release eggs regularly.

2. Excess Androgen Levels – Polycystic Ovary Syndrome (PCOS)

High androgen (male hormone) levels cause:

  • Hirsutism: Excess facial or body hair growth
  • Severe acne or oily skin
  • Thinning scalp hair or baldness

3. Polycystic Ovaries – Polycystic Ovary Syndrome (PCOS)

Ultrasound may reveal multiple small cysts in the ovaries. These immature follicles often prevent regular ovulation.

4. Weight Gain & Obesity – Polycystic Ovary Syndrome (PCOS)

Many women with Polycystic Ovary Syndrome struggle with weight gain, especially around the abdomen, due to insulin resistance.

5. Insulin Resistance – Polycystic Ovary Syndrome (PCOS)

Insulin resistance can result in:

  • Low energy and fatigue
  • Sugar cravings and increased appetite
  • Dark skin patches (acanthosis nigricans)
  • Risk of type 2 diabetes if untreated

6. Fertility Issues – Polycystic Ovary Syndrome (PCOS)

Because ovulation is irregular, women with PCOS may experience infertility or difficulty conceiving.

7. Mood Disorders – Polycystic Ovary Syndrome (PCOS)

Hormonal changes and symptoms may lead to:

  • Anxiety
  • Depression
  • Low self-esteem
  • Mood swings

8. Other Symptoms

  • Sleep apnea
  • Pelvic pain
  • Skin tags around the neck or armpits

Diagnosis of Polycystic Ovary Syndrome (PCOS)

A gynecologist usually diagnoses PCOS using:

  • Medical history and physical exam
  • Hormone blood tests
  • Pelvic ultrasound

Doctors often follow Rotterdam criteria, requiring 2 out of 3:

  • Irregular or absent ovulation
  • Elevated androgens
  • Polycystic ovaries on ultrasound

Treatment Options for Polycystic Ovary Syndrome (PCOS)

Although there is no cure for Polycystic Ovary Syndrome, treatments can manage symptoms:

  • Lifestyle changes: Healthy diet, weight loss, and exercise improve insulin resistance.
  • Medications: Birth control pills, anti-androgen drugs, and metformin help regulate hormones.
  • Fertility support: Ovulation-inducing medications if pregnancy is desired.
  • Hair removal therapies: Laser or electrolysis for excess hair.
  • Mental health support: Counseling or therapy for emotional well-being.

When to See a Doctor?

If you notice irregular periods, excess hair growth, unexplained weight gain, or difficulty conceiving, consult a gynecologist. Early diagnosis and treatment of Polycystic Ovary Syndrome can help prevent complications such as diabetes, infertility, heart disease, and endometrial cancer.

FAQs — Polycystic Ovary Syndrome (PCOS)

1. What is Polycystic Ovary Syndrome (PCOS)?
Polycystic Ovary Syndrome (PCOS) is a hormonal disorder that affects women of reproductive age, leading to irregular periods, ovarian cysts, excess male hormones, and fertility problems.

2. What are the early symptoms of PCOS?
Early symptoms of PCOS include irregular menstrual cycles, acne, excessive hair growth, weight gain, and difficulty conceiving. Recognizing these signs early helps in better management.

3. Can PCOS cause infertility?
Yes, PCOS often disrupts ovulation, which makes conceiving difficult. However, with timely treatment, lifestyle changes, and medical support, many women with PCOS can achieve pregnancy.

4. How is PCOS diagnosed?
Doctors diagnose PCOS through a detailed medical history, physical examination, hormone blood tests, and ultrasound to detect ovarian cysts.

5. Can PCOS be cured permanently?
There is no permanent cure for PCOS, but symptoms can be effectively managed through lifestyle modifications, medications, and regular healthcare follow-ups.
